Shri Siddhivinayak Ganesh Temple, popularly known as Sarasbaug Ganpati, is one of the most revered and iconic Ganesh temples in Pune. Located inside the historic Sarasbaug, the temple is a major spiritual and cultural landmark of the city.

The temple was built in the 18th century during the Peshwa period, when Sarasbaug was developed as a beautiful lake-garden complex. At the heart of this garden stands the Siddhivinayak temple, dedicated to Lord Ganesha, the remover of obstacles and the giver of wisdom and prosperity.

The idol of Lord Ganesha here is believed to be “Siddhi-pradayak”—one who fulfills devotees’ wishes. The serene surroundings of the garden combined with the spiritual aura of the temple make it a peaceful place for prayer and meditation, even though it is located in the heart of the city.

Thousands of devotees visit the temple daily, with special crowds on Tuesdays, Ganesh Chaturthi, Sankashti Chaturthi, and during Ganeshotsav. The temple holds deep emotional significance for Punekars and is considered one of the city’s most important Ganesh shrines.
